Transportation YOU

Webinar Series

 

The Central VA Chapter of the Women's Transportation Seminar (WTS) will be hosting FREE webinar panel events throughout the 2024-2025 school calendar. These webinars are catered to women in grades 6-12, but all interested attendees are welcome to participate. The focus of this webinar series is to highlight a project or person within the Commonwealth of Virginia, or offer resources to students interested in  ST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ering & Math).

Each webinar will be held from 4:00 - 5:00 PM (EST) via our Zoom virtual platform, unless otherwise stated.

STEM Expo - Sea Air Space

April 6-9, 2025
Gaylord National Resort & Convention Center - Maryland

The Navy League of the United States is celebrating the return of our annual STEM Expo, now in its 7th year.

Geared toward 5th through 12th grade students, this free event inspires and empowers students interested in science, technology, engineering and math careers.

Students and parents are invited to enjoy interactive STEM workshops, hands-on demonstrations, STEM career information, networking opportunities and more.

Celebrate Earth Day with Virginia State Parks

Tuesday, April 22nd

In celebration of Earth Day on April 22, Virginia State Parks offers a range of special events and activities highlighting the importance of conservation and sustainability. Visitors are invited to participate in educational programs, guided nature walks, wildlife observation, tree plantings and service projects to help preserve the beauty and biodiversity of the state’s 43 parks. The theme for Earth Day 2025 is “Our Power, Our Planet”! This powerful campaign emphasizes the collective responsibility we all share in transitioning to renewable energy sources and creating a sustainable future.
